The word load is a noun. Load means (1) goods carried by a large vehicle, (2) weight to be borne or conveyed, (3) electrical device to which electrical power is delivered, (4) the front part of a guided missile or rocket or torpedo that carries the nuclear or explosive charge or the chemical or biological agents, (5) an onerous or difficult concern, (6) a deposit of valuable ore occurring within definite boundaries separating it from surrounding rocks, (7) the power output of a generator or power plant, (8) an amount of alcohol sufficient to intoxicate, (9) a quantity that can be processed or transported at one time.
Load is also a verb that means (1) fill or place a load on, (2) provide with munition, (3) put (something) on a structure or conveyance.
